Ingredients for Crispy Air Fryer Zucchini

Here’s a concise list of everything you’ll need for this recipe:

  • 2 medium zucchinis, washed and sliced thin
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t to taste
  • Pepper to taste

How to Make Crispy Air Fryer Zucchini (Step‑by‑Step)

Step 1: Prepare the Zucchini

Wash the zucchinis under cold water, then slice them into uniform rounds about ¼ inch thick. Uniform thickness ensures even cooking and consistent crispness across all pieces.

Step 2: Dry and Season

Pat the slices dry with paper towels to remove excess moisture, which can steam the vegetables instead of crisping them. Transfer the dry slices to a large bowl.

Step 3: Add Oil and Spices

Drizzle the olive oil over the zucchini slices, then sprinkle gar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, salt, and pepper. Toss gently until each slice is lightly coated. The oil helps the spices adhere and contributes to the golden crust.

Step 4: Preheat the Air Fryer

Set your air fryer to 400°F (200°C) and let it preheat for 3‑5 minutes. A properly preheated appliance creates an immediate burst of hot air, which is essential for that crisp exterior.

Step 5: Arrange the Slices

Lay the seasoned zucchini rounds in a single layer inside the air fryer basket. Avoid overlapping; if necessary, work in batches to maintain airflow around each piece.

Step 6: Cook and Flip

Air fry for 10‑12 minutes, shaking or flipping the slices halfway through the cooking time. This ensures both sides become evenly golden and crunchy.

Step 7: Cool and Serve

When the edges turn a deep golden brown, remove the chips and let them rest for a minute or two. The residual heat finishes the crisping process, and the brief cooling prevents sogginess.

Variations and Twists

While the classic version is already delicious, you can experiment with a range of flavor profiles. Add a pinch of cayenne or chili powder for heat, or mix in dried herbs like oregano or thyme for an Italian flair. For a cheesy note, sprinkle a modest amount of nutritional yeast after cooking. If you enjoy a sweet‑savory combo, lightly dust the finished chips with a blend of cinnamon and a touch of brown sugar.

Pro Tips for Perfect Results

  • Slice uniformly: Use a mandoline for consistent thickness.
  • Dry thoroughly: Excess moisture hinders crisping.
  • Don’t overcrowd: Air needs to circulate around each slice.
  • Flip halfway: Guarantees even browning on both sides.
  • Season after cooking for extra flavor boost.

Following these tips will help you achieve restaurant‑quality zucchini chips every time.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Using too much oil: Leads to soggy, greasy chips.
  • Overlapping slices: Traps steam and prevents crispness.
  • Skipping the preheat: Results in uneven texture.
  • Cooking for too long: Can burn the delicate edges.

Understanding these pitfalls ensures you stay on the path to crispy perfection.

Storage, Reheating & Make‑Ahead Tips

If you have leftovers, store the cooled zucchini chips in an airtight container at room temperature for up to two days. To restore crispness, reheat them in the air fryer at 350°F for 2‑3 minutes. For longer storage, freeze the raw, sliced zucchini on a baking sheet, then transfer to a zip‑top bag; you can air fry them directly from frozen, adding a minute to the cooking time.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use a regular oven instead of an air fryer? Yes, set the oven to 425°F, place the slices on a parchment‑lined sheet, and bake for 15‑20 minutes, flipping halfway.

Do I need to coat the zucchini with oil? A light coating helps achieve a golden crust, but you can use a cooking spray for an even lighter option.

How thin should the slices be? Aim for about ¼ inch; thinner slices crisp faster but can burn if too thin.

Can I add cheese? Sprinkle a small amount of grated Parmesan or nutritional yeast after cooking for a cheesy note.

Are these chips suitable for a low‑carb diet? Yes, zucchini is low in carbs, making these chips a great low‑carb snack.
